Output 3ba4891616d269fed03d10f184bd129c40b771a8826c227b7eb152f813913fd3:1

value
169421568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bdd5c264848da86d3fb726cc8353554bc0ffb1 OP_EQUAL
address
3MuUfuT8KBKENi1CMWRs4aCCqUfcikQVwD
transaction
3ba4891616d269fed03d10f184bd129c40b771a8826c227b7eb152f813913fd3
spent
true